Description

"I don't believe in the big bad mouse..." One night, the Gruffalo's child wanders into the woods to search for the Big Bad Mouse. Instead, she comes upon a small mouse in the woods... and decides to eat him!But wait, what is that? A shadow of a very large, scary creature falls on the ground, and suddenly the Gruffalo's child is frightened. Could it be the Big Bad Mouse after all?'The Gruffalo's Child' (2004) is the Number One best-selling, much-loved sequel to the worldwide picture-book phenomenon that is 'The Gruffalo' (1999), and the continuation of The Gruffalo Series. Julia Donaldson's trademark rhyming text and Axel Scheffler's brilliant, characterful illustrations combine once more to ensure that the Gruffalo's child has followed firmly in her father's footsteps, and that her story is one that children will ask for again, and again...and again!
